Director of Photography Halyna Hutchins was killed and director Joel Souza was injured on set while filming the movie “Rust” at Bonanza Creek Ranch near Santa Fe, New Mexico on October 21, 2021. The film’s star and producer Alec Baldwin discharged a prop firearm that hit Hutchins and Souza.

Prosecutors allegeRustarmorerHannah Gutierrez-Reedwas “likely” hungover when she loaded the prop gun that resulted incinematographer Halyna Hutchins’s death back in October 2021.

On Friday, prosecutors in New Mexico’s criminal case against Gutierrez-Reedrespondedto the armorer’s attorney’s motion to dismiss the charges against her, stating she is being “appropriately prosecuted because her primary function as an armorer on theRustmovie set was to ensure gun safety.”

“Her reckless failure resulted in the senseless death of another human being,” special prosecutors Kari T. Morrissey and Jason J. Lewis alleged in the court filing. “All Defendant Gutierrez needed to do was shake every bullet and make sure it rattled before putting it in the gun — she failed and killed someone.”

The special prosecutors claimed that witnesses in the state’s current case against Gutierrez-Reed — criminal charges against Alec Baldwin, 65, weredropped back in April— “will testify that Defendant Gutierrez was drinking heavily and smoking marijuana in the evenings during the shooting ofRust.”

In a statement to PEOPLE Wednesday, Gutierrez-Reed’s attorney Jason Bowles said the prosecution “has so mishandled this case and the case is so weak that they are now resorting to character assassination tactics to further taint the jury pool.”

“This investigation and prosecution has not been about seeking Justice; for them it’s been about finding a convenient scapegoat,” he added.

The special prosecutors added in their filing that Gutierrez-Reed has “previously been sued civilly for providing the keys to her motorcycle to an intoxicated person who was predictably involved in a motor vehicle accident that resulted in someone’s death.”

“Defendant Gutierrez has a history of reckless conduct that has resulted in loss of human life and it is in the public interest that she finally be held accountable,” the prosecutors wrote in the court filing.

Elsewhere in the court filing, the prosecutors noted that they anticipate making a final decision on criminal charges involving Baldwin “within the next 60 days.”

“The charges against Alec Baldwin were dismissed without prejudice because a possible malfunction of the gun significantly effects causation with regard to Baldwin, not with regard to Gutierrez," they wrote in the court filing. “If it is determined that the gun did not malfunction, charges against Mr. Baldwin will proceed.”

Upon thedismissal of Baldwin’s criminal charges in April, the prosecutors did note that the decision “does not absolve Mr. Baldwin of criminal culpability and charges may be refiled.”

The team behindRust, including Baldwin and director Joel Souza, who was injured in the on-set shooting, resumed production andcompleted the film earlier this year.
